L628 WFB is a 1994 Fiat Tipo in Green with a 1,372c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 38.5%.
Across all 1994 Fiat Tipo models, the average MOT pass rate is 60.6% with a typical mileage of 84,804 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Tipo f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 5,060 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L628 WFB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Tipo typ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 32 years old, this Fiat Tipo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
